T-Mobile One Plan Empty T-Mobile One Plan

Post by kiko Thu Jun 22, 2017 9:13 am

Does anyone here have first hand experience with this plan that offers unlimited data in Mexico, US, and Canada? Most plans limit your data usage when in Mexico, but it is my understanding that this plan at 70USD/month has unlimited data across both the US and Mexico.

Post by windrider17 Fri Jun 23, 2017 7:37 am

I have the TMobil plan for North America, purchased in Austin. I have to use it over 50% in the US or roaming charges kick in. I have been told to get a second line that someone will use in the US all of the time and that will make the balance work for me. When I signed up I was very clear that I live here and that 90% of the usage would be in MX. They said no problem. Not true from what I now understand,

Post by MusicDocB Fri Jun 23, 2017 11:17 am

The T-mobile plans work very well here until they don't. You will find many discussions about this on the Facebook forums. If your percentage of usage in Mexico becomes greater than your usage in the States, they will cancel your service. I had the plan and it was fine until I lived here full-time for about 3 months. I then got a message that my service would be discontinued because of excessive usage in Mexico.
